老铁们,这个好!
OpenSaaS :一个100%免费开源的SaaS软件模板
它提供了一个预先配置好的、功能丰富的平台,可以在此基础上直接构建自己的应用程序。
包括了用户认证系统、内置博客、支付系统、OpenAI API、数据分析仪表板等多种实用功能。
使用可以快速搭建和启动在线服务,特别适合小型团队和个人开发者。
网站:https://t.co/HOAAJ2eKTu
作者:@hot_town
例子:创建在线健身订阅服务
假设你是一位健身教练,想要创建一个在线健身订阅服务,提供视频课程和个性化健身计划。你需要一个网站来管理用户注册、订阅付费、视频内容发布等功能。
1、使用 OpenSaaS 开始:
• 你可以使用 OpenSaaS 作为起点。由于它是一个预配置的 SaaS 模板,你不需要从零开始编写代码。
• OpenSaaS 提供了用户认证(注册和登录)、支付处理(如 Stripe 集成)等基础功能。
2、定制和扩展:
• 你可以在 OpenSaaS 的基础上添加自己的特色功能,比如上传健身视频、创建个性化健身计划等。
• 由于 OpenSaaS 支持全栈类型安全和内置博客系统,你还可以添加健身相关的博客内容来提升网站的吸引力和SEO表现。
3、部署和运营:
• 完成定制后,你可以选择在云服务上部署你的网站,OpenSaaS 支持多种部署选项。
• 通过管理仪表板,你可以跟踪用户注册、订阅情况和收入等关键数据。
使用 OpenSaaS,你可以快速搭建起一个功能完备的在线健身订阅服务网站,无需深入了解所有技术细节,同时还能根据自己的需求进行定制和扩展。
主要功能:
• 100% 开源:没有供应商锁定,可以在任何地方部署。
• 完全开源:代码库和框架完全开源,服务尽可能开源。
• 自助式身份验证:预配置的全栈身份验证,无需第三方服务或隐藏费用。
• 全栈类型安全:完全支持 TypeScript,自动生成覆盖整个栈的类型。
• Stripe 集成:内置订阅和必要的 Webhooks,适用于需要支付功能的 SaaS。
• 管理仪表板:包括图表、表格和分析工具,如 Plausible 或 Google Analytics。
• 内置博客:使用 Astro 框架构建的博客,支持 Markdown 编写,有助于提升 SEO 性能。
• 邮件发送功能:内置邮件发送功能,可与定时任务功能结合,方便向客户发送邮件。
• OpenAI API 实现:适用于 AI 驱动的应用,集成了OpenAI API 。
• 随处部署:由于完全拥有代码,可以自行部署,或使用 Wasp 一键部署。
• 完整的文档和支持:提供详细的文档和 Discord 社区支持。